Pick a Format

There are no right or wrong ways to write a business plan. However, it’s important to note that it should meet your needs. Most plans are written in two categories: lean startup or traditional.

Traditional business plans are usually written in a standard format, encouraging you to go into more detail in each section. These typically take a lot of work to start, and they can be lengthy. Lean startup business plans, on the other hand, are more common. They focus on the most critical points of the plan, and they can be written on just one page.

Write an Executive Summary

Your executive summary should be the first page of your plan, including a mission statement and a brief description of the services or products you’re offering. Although it’s the first thing investors will see, it can also be easier to write it last. This section should highlight the other sections’ information you’ve already identified.

Description

Your company’s name and address should also be included in the next section of the document. It should also include the names of key individuals in the organization and the company’s structure. This section should also have the total ownership of the company. 

Business Goals

A business plan’s third section should be an objective statement, which provides a comprehensive view of what you’re planning on doing and how you’ll achieve it. This section should also explain the various factors that will help you grow the company. This section should be very informative if you’re looking for a loan or an investment. It should include a clear explanation of your potential opportunities and how the money will help you achieve your goals.

Products & Services

In the Products & Services section, you should explain how your product or service works and briefly describe the pricing model you’re planning on using. You should also include an overview of other factors that will help you grow the business. These include the distribution strategy, the supply chain, and the sales process.
